VO2 Maxthe maximum rate of oxygen consumption during intense exercise, is a critical measure of an athlete’s aerobic capacity and endurance. It reflects the efficiency with which the body can transport and utilize oxygen in the muscles during sustained physical activity. A higher VO2max allows athletes to perform at higher intensities for longer periods without fatiguing, making it a key factor in sports that require endurance, such as running, cycling, and swimming. By training to improve VO2max, athletes can enhance their overall performance, delay the onset of fatigue, and achieve better results in both aerobic and anaerobic activities.

FatOx & Fat/Carb Burn%Knowing your FatOx levels—the exercise intensity at which your body burns the most fat as fuel—can be highly beneficial for athletes. By identifying your FatOx, you can optimize your training sessions to enhance fat oxidation, which is particularly valuable in endurance sports where efficient energy use is critical for prolonged performance. Training at or near your FatOx can improve your metabolic flexibility, allowing you to rely more on fat stores during long-duration activities, thereby sparing glycogen and delaying the onset of fatigue. This knowledge enables you to tailor your workouts to increase fat-burning efficiency, improve endurance, and manage body composition, all of which contribute to better athletic performance and overall fitness.

Training Zones & Recovery Metabolic Testing gives you a true Aerobic and Anaerobic Threshold value which means your Training Zones will be correct! Often when performing more basic field tests (FTP, 5k run, Etc) the Anaerobic Threshold value will often be 5-10beats higher meaning your training zones could be completely out. Also through training your aerobic and anaerobic threshold will change – so it’s important to reassess to see progress and reset training zones. We also use a muscle oxygen sensor in our performance tests which has been shown to give similar results to blood lactate testing but in a non evasive manner. As we use both the Calibre Metabolic Analyser (measuring respiration – O2/CO2) and the Train.Red muscle sensor (measuring SmO2 – muscle oxygen saturation) we not only cover all bases but gain additional insights into the exact recovery we need both short term during a session and long term within a structured plan for your triathlon, cycling or fitness goals.
